Costco (COST) October Comps Fall 1%

November 6, 2008 7:28 AM EST
Costco Wholesale Corporation (Nasdaq: COST) October Comparable sales fell 1%, versus the consensus of a 3.6% rise.

net sales of $5.30 billion for the month of October, the four weeks ended November 2, 2008, an increase of two percent from $5.21 billion in the same four-week period last year.

Excluding the negative effect of foreign exchange (particularly in Canada, the U.K. and Korea), international comparable sales for October increased 9% in local currency, and total Company comparable sales would have increased by 3% for the month. Gasoline price changes year-over-year had no material impact on sales for the month.
